Management of Dystocia Due to Fetal Ascites in Boer Goat: A Case Report

Author(s): Abhishek Bhardwaj, Sheetal SK, Sahatpure SK and Bawaskar MS
Abstract: Dystocia in goats is due to fetal causes is uncommon. However, there are reports suggesting dystocia due to fetal dropsy. Present case report show dystocia in Boer goat due to fetal ascites. This case report is about the successful management of dystocia due to fetal ascites in Boer goat by giving an incision on the hind limb and making an entry into the fetal abdomen to take out the fluid. Evisceration was done for completely removing the fetus.
